At its core, Venmo’s genius lies in its psychological reframing of payment. For years, the act of paying someone, especially for small amounts, was often an awkward dance involving cash, scribbled IOUs, or the stressful math of splitting a dinner check. Venmo eliminated this friction by creating a quasi-social space where money could move with the ease and informality of a text message. By allowing users to add comments, use emojis, and share transactions to a news feed visible to friends, the company transformed a sterile financial transaction into a more human, almost playful interaction. This "social lubricant" strategy was not merely a gimmick; it was a masterstroke of user experience that drove virality. Friends who were not on the app were compelled to join in order to receive their share of rent or a group dinner, creating a powerful network effect that expanded its user base exponentially without the heavy marketing costs traditional banks incur. The app’s success is rooted in its deep understanding that in the digital age, payment is as much about social validation and ease as it is about the transfer of capital.
